> The clang option -Oz enables *aggressive* optimization for size,
> which doesn't necessarily result in smaller images, but can have
> negative impact on performance. Switch back to the less aggressive
> -Os.
>
> This reverts commit 6748cb3c299de1ffbe56733647b01dbcc398c419.

Does scripts/checkpatch.pl complain about this format (full sha, no
title)?  Not sure that necessitates a v2, but if so would be good to
mention that Clang generates excessive calls into libgcc/compiler-rt
at -Oz.  Thanks for the patch and the discussion/sanity check.
